Lakeside College is a prep‑to‑12 co‑educational Christian school in the Lutheran tradition, located in Pakenham, close to Melbourne’s south‑east CBD.
Responsibilities
- Teach mathematics and science to secondary students.
- Develop and deliver curriculum aligned with state standards.
- Assess student progress and provide feedback.
- Contribute to pastoral care and homeroom responsibilities.
- Participate in school activities, including compulsory camp programs and outdoor education camps.
- Support school‑wide initiatives and events.
- Maintain a child‑safe setting and comply with Child Safe Standards.
- Participate in professional development and training, particularly in child safety and digital technology integration.
Qualifications and Key Selection Criteria
- Active Christian faith and willingness to uphold the ethos of the Lutheran Church of Australia.
- High level of communication and interpersonal skills when relating to students, parents, and other staff.
- Ability to select and use a wide range of teaching and assessment strategies to suit the needs of a diverse range of students.
- Commitment and capacity to actively contribute to a broad range of school activities as a member of the College team.
- Capacity and ability to contribute to our camp program and possess adequate fitness to participate in a range of outdoor education camps.
- Capacity to establish and develop positive and constructive relationships with students, staff, parents, and members of the wider community.
- Ability and desire to contribute to the Pastoral Care program of the College and serve as a homeroom/pastoral care teacher.
- Capacity to reflect critically upon their professional practice.
- Capacity for best practice in curriculum development and implementation, evaluation and assessment, and management of teaching and learning activities.
- Ability to apply digital technologies to the teaching and learning process as well as collecting, organising, and processing relevant data.
- Ability and willingness to teach outside of Mathematics and Science in the Secondary school will be of great advantage.
